Output 51bbfa5e8185beaf8ecb828387ceea352c8e7ddaa122d828081fb7d9fb2be784:12

value
13940000
script pubkey
OP_0 OP_PUSHBYTES_32 2811c38995688a0472f71e1c3ce9f8ae6a472f1f0e8b02c83938722638b2f5a6
address
bc1q9qgu8zv4dz9qguhhrcwre60c4e4ywtclp69s9jpe8pezvw9j7knqa5f0ga
transaction
51bbfa5e8185beaf8ecb828387ceea352c8e7ddaa122d828081fb7d9fb2be784
confirmations
133632
spent
true